Discussion Idea for tweaking Mello to discourage working with him

Had a random thought while watching the 500th lobby refuse to vote him out - what if, instead of the game ending when Mello shoots Kira, have the game continue but Mello 'becomes' Kira by taking the notebook? His role at this point would be 'M-Kira'.

As soon as 'M-Kira' enters play:

  • The original Kira/X-Kira loses the game.
  • Any Follower the previous Kira/X-Kira had joins L's team if alive and not arrested, still as Follower/Spokesperson, but they lose their abilities, and any IDs they were holding are returned.
  • M-Kira retains the ability to shoot but now also has the abilities Kira/X-Kira had (Death Note + Command Cards), except X-Kira's conversion. M-Kira's objective is the same as Kira's; Kill L/N. This can be done via Mello's shot, the Death Note, or New World Progress.
  • If M-Kira wins, the ending screen shows him and only him above the board, holding the Death Note with an evil grin.

One other tweak I would make is that NPCs DO give testimony if Mello/M-Kira shoots someone in front of them.

This version of Mello solves two major issues he has right now - one is his random shots causing sudden and instant losses that aren't any fun for anyone other than the Mello player. The other is the classic 'don't vote Mello' mentality that makes anybody trying to properly win on Team L face a real uphill battle.

As a side note, I like the idea of a little mind game where, if Mello publicly shoots someone and doesn't hit Kira, Kira/Follower can easily claim to have changed teams and tempt L into voting Mello out. A bit like people claiming to have gotten their ID back following a shot.
